Name of the Condition
- Corrosion of first degree of multiple sites of left ankle and foot, sequela
Summary
This condition represents a first-degree corrosive injury affecting multiple sites of the left ankle and foot, classified as a sequela. First-degree corrosions are superficial, limited to the outer layer of skin (epidermis), and typically heal without scarring. The sequela designation indicates this is a residual effect of a prior corrosive injury, with ongoing or resolved tissue changes resulting from the initial event.
Causes
Corrosions of the left ankle and foot may occur due to contact with caustic chemicals, such as acids, alkalis, or other corrosive agents. Brief exposure to these substances can lead to superficial skin damage. Common sources include household cleaning products, industrial chemicals, or accidental spills. The sequela arises as a consequence of the initial corrosive injury, reflecting persistent or healed tissue changes.

Diagnosis
Diagnosis involves a physical examination to assess residual tissue changes, such as scarring, discoloration, or altered skin texture, consistent with a prior corrosive injury. Clinical history of the initial event and its timeline is critical to confirm the sequela status. No active corrosive exposure is present, distinguishing this from an acute injury.
Treatment Options
Treatment focuses on managing residual symptoms and preventing further injury. This may include topical moisturizers to address dryness, protective footwear to avoid irritation, and monitoring for signs of infection. In some cases, scar management techniques or physical therapy may be recommended to improve mobility or appearance.
Prognosis and Follow-Up
The prognosis for first-degree corrosive sequela is generally favorable, with most residual effects resolving over time. Follow-up care may involve periodic assessments to ensure no progression of tissue changes and to address any functional or cosmetic concerns. Long-term monitoring is typically unnecessary unless complications arise.
Complications
Potential complications include chronic skin changes, such as persistent discoloration or sensitivity, or secondary infections if the area is compromised. Rarely, severe scarring may affect mobility or require additional intervention.

Tips for Medical Coders
This code (T25.592S) is used for first-degree corrosive injuries of the left ankle and foot with sequela. Documentation should clearly indicate the residual effects of a prior corrosive injury, including the affected sites and the absence of active exposure. Ensure the sequela designation is supported by clinical findings and history to align with coding guidelines.
